The Heart of Sandwell Day Hospital is situated at Rowley Regis Hospital. The service was previously provided at Bradbury House, on the Wolverhampton Road in Oldbury but relocated to its present location on 1st April 2017.
As a registered adult’s residential home, Wellcroft House provides ongoing support for young people. Focusing on enabling greater independence for those with moderate to severe learning difficulties and complex disabilities. It supports a maximum of six residents.
Parkside Health Care Limited is registered to provide accommodation, nursing or personal care for up to 20 people, who have a mental health or physical health condition.
Alphonsus House provides leading person-centred support and facilities for 19adults over the age of 18 with mental health requirements, autism and learning or physical disabilities.
Karam Court has a capacity for 47. At the time of our visit there were 45 residents. All the residents have some form of dementia or Alzheimer’s or schizophrenia.
Pegasus Care Home is situated at 65-67 Beeches Road, West Bromwich. It is registered to provide accommodation and support to 12 people with a learning disability, a mental health condition, physical disability, and sensory impairment
The Poplars Nursing Home provides residential nursing care to predominantly elderly people over 65’s with some respite care also made available. The home accommodates a number of residents with varying degrees of Dementia. The Poplars also provides palliative care in conjunction with the Palliative Care Team.
